प्रश्न
Solve `2/3` (x + 1) + 4 < 10 and represent its solution on a number line.
Given replacement set is {-8, -6, -4, 3, 6, 8, 12}.
Advertisements
उत्तर
`2/3` (x + 1) + 4 < 10
`=> 2/3 ("x" - 1) < 10 - 4`
`=> 2/3 ("x" - 1) < 6`
⇒ 2(x − 1) < 18
⇒ x − 1 < 9
⇒ x − 1 + 1 < 9 + 1 ...(Adding 1 to both sides)
⇒ x < 10

Thus x < 10
Since, replacement set = {−8, −6, −4, 3, 6, 8, 12}
⇒ Solution set = {−8, −6, −4, 3, 6, 8}
